#4681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4681ce is composed of 27.5% red, 50.6%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66% cyan, 37.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 214 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 54.1%. #4681ce color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ffff with #00039d.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#4681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4681ce has RGB values of R:70, G:129,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 4620750.

Shades and Tints of #4681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1f5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4681ce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#85898f is the less saturated color, while #197bfb is the most saturated one.
